Town of North Stonington
Board of Selectmen Meeting
New Town Hall Conference Room
May 24, 2016
7:00 PM
MINUTES
1.
Call to Order/ Roll Call-7:06 PM with First Selectman Murphy and Selectmen Donahue and Mullane present.
2.
Pledge of Allegiance
3.
Public Comments and Questions-Brad Borden commented on State finances and the fact the school bonding funds are being cut, do we know if this will effect North Stonington’s applications?
4.
Correspondence
5.
Minutes- A motion was made by Selectman Mullane and seconded by Selectman Donahue to approve the minutes of the May 10, 2016 Selectmen’s meeting as amended, carrying. 3-0
6.
NSAA Run Status Report-No response from NSAA president Elias to Selectmen’s request to attend this meeting.
7.
Projects Update-First Selectman Murphy gave an overview of the STEAP waterline extension project, sewer study, water study and street numbering projects that are ongoing.
8.
2016-2017 Budget Status –After general discussion the First Selectman Murphy made a motion to forward several reductions to the FY 2016-17 budget in the following line items, seconded by Selectman
Donahue, carrying. 3-0
Elections and Town Meetings B21.02 $5,000
Board of Assessment Appeals B 5.0 $ 500
Inland Wetlands Commission Expenses B17.0 $ 500
9.
Transfer Request to Tribal Recognition Account-A motion was made by Selectman Donahue and seconded by Selectman Murphy to request a transfer for B9.01 Tribal Recognition in the amount of $12,000
from B10.01 Wages Admin Asst. $2,500, B6.01 Wages Clerical $5,000, B20.04 Social Security $4,500, carrying. 3-0
